Buat Formulir Survei
Tujuan: Bangun aplikasi yang fungsinya mirip dengan https://survey-form.freecodecamp.rocks
Cerita Pengguna:
Anda harus memiliki judul halaman dalam elemen h1 dengan id judul
Anda harus memiliki penjelasan singkat dalam elemen p dengan id deskripsi
Anda harus memiliki elemen formulir dengan id formulir survei
Di dalam elemen formulir, Anda diharuskan memasukkan nama Anda di kolom input yang memiliki id nama dan jenis teks
Di dalam elemen formulir, Anda diminta untuk memasukkan email Anda di kolom input yang memiliki id email
Jika Anda memasukkan email yang tidak diformat dengan benar, Anda akan melihat kesalahan validasi HTML5
Di dalam formulir, Anda dapat memasukkan nomor di kolom input yang memiliki id nomor
Masukan angka tidak boleh menerima non-angka, baik dengan mencegah Anda mengetiknya atau dengan menunjukkan kesalahan validasi HTML5 (bergantung pada browser Anda).
Jika Anda memasukkan angka di luar rentang masukan angka, yang ditentukan oleh atribut min dan max, Anda akan melihat kesalahan validasi HTML5
Untuk bidang input nama, email, dan nomor, Anda dapat melihat elemen label yang sesuai dalam formulir, yang menjelaskan tujuan setiap bidang dengan id berikut: id="nama-label", id="label-email", dan id="nomor-label"
Untuk bidang input nama, email, dan nomor, Anda dapat melihat teks placeholder yang memberikan deskripsi atau petunjuk untuk setiap bidang
Di dalam elemen form, Anda harus memiliki elemen dropdown pilih dengan id dropdown dan setidaknya dua opsi untuk dipilih
Di dalam elemen formulir, Anda dapat memilih opsi dari grup yang terdiri dari setidaknya dua tombol radio yang dikelompokkan menggunakan atribut nama
Di dalam elemen formulir, Anda dapat memilih beberapa bidang dari rangkaian kotak centang, yang masing-masing harus memiliki atribut nilai
Di dalam elemen form, Anda disajikan dengan textarea untuk komentar tambahan
Di dalam elemen formulir, Anda disajikan tombol dengan id kirim untuk mengirimkan semua masukan
Penuhi cerita pengguna dan lewati semua tes di bawah untuk menyelesaikan proyek ini. Berikan gaya pribadi Anda sendiri. Selamat Coding!
Catatan: Pastikan untuk menambahkan <link rel="stylesheet" href="styles.css"> di HTML Anda untuk menautkan stylesheet dan menerapkan CSS Anda.
Tujuan: Bangun aplikasi yang fungsinya mirip dengan https://survey-form.freecodecamp.rocks
Cerita Pengguna:
Anda harus memiliki judul halaman dalam elemen h1 dengan id judul
Anda harus memiliki penjelasan singkat dalam elemen p dengan id deskripsi
Anda harus memiliki elemen formulir dengan id formulir survei
Di dalam elemen formulir, Anda diharuskan memasukkan nama Anda di kolom input yang memiliki id nama dan jenis teks
Di dalam elemen formulir, Anda diminta untuk memasukkan email Anda di kolom input yang memiliki id email
Jika Anda memasukkan email yang tidak diformat dengan benar, Anda akan melihat kesalahan validasi HTML5
Di dalam formulir, Anda dapat memasukkan nomor di kolom input yang memiliki id nomor
Masukan angka tidak boleh menerima non-angka, baik dengan mencegah Anda mengetiknya atau dengan menunjukkan kesalahan validasi HTML5 (bergantung pada browser Anda).
Jika Anda memasukkan angka di luar rentang masukan angka, yang ditentukan oleh atribut min dan max, Anda akan melihat kesalahan validasi HTML5
Untuk bidang input nama, email, dan nomor, Anda dapat melihat elemen label yang sesuai dalam formulir, yang menjelaskan tujuan setiap bidang dengan id berikut: id="nama-label", id="label-email", dan id="nomor-label"
Untuk bidang input nama, email, dan nomor, Anda dapat melihat teks placeholder yang memberikan deskripsi atau petunjuk untuk setiap bidang
Di dalam elemen form, Anda harus memiliki elemen dropdown pilih dengan id dropdown dan setidaknya dua opsi untuk dipilih
Di dalam elemen formulir, Anda dapat memilih opsi dari grup yang terdiri dari setidaknya dua tombol radio yang dikelompokkan menggunakan atribut nama
Di dalam elemen formulir, Anda dapat memilih beberapa bidang dari rangkaian kotak centang, yang masing-masing harus memiliki atribut nilai
Di dalam elemen form, Anda disajikan dengan textarea untuk komentar tambahan
Di dalam elemen formulir, Anda disajikan tombol dengan id kirim untuk mengirimkan semua masukan
Penuhi cerita pengguna dan lewati semua tes di bawah untuk menyelesaikan proyek ini. Berikan gaya pribadi Anda sendiri. Selamat Coding!
Catatan: Pastikan untuk menambahkan <link rel="stylesheet" href="styles.css"> di HTML Anda untuk menautkan stylesheet dan menerapkan CSS Anda.
Silahkan merapat ke website dibawah ini, untuk melihat contoh project:
Tes
Menunggu: Anda harus memiliki elemen h1 dengan id judul.
Menunggu: #judul Anda tidak boleh kosong.
Menunggu: Anda harus memiliki elemen p dengan id deskripsi.
Menunggu: #deskripsi Anda tidak boleh kosong.
Menunggu: Anda harus memiliki elemen formulir dengan id formulir survei.
Menunggu: Anda harus memiliki elemen input dengan id nama.
Menunggu: #nama Anda harus memiliki jenis teks.
Menunggu: #nama Anda harus memerlukan masukan.
Menunggu: #nama Anda harus turunan dari #survey-form.
Menunggu: Anda harus memiliki elemen input dengan id email.
Menunggu: #email Anda harus memiliki jenis email.
Menunggu: #email Anda harus meminta masukan.
Menunggu: #email Anda harus turunan dari #survey-form.
Menunggu: Anda harus memiliki elemen input dengan id nomor.
Menunggu: #nomor Anda harus turunan dari #formulir survei.
Menunggu: #nomor Anda harus memiliki jenis nomor.
Menunggu: #nomor Anda harus memiliki atribut min dengan nilai numerik.
Menunggu: #nomor Anda harus memiliki atribut maks dengan nilai numerik.
Menunggu: Anda harus memiliki elemen label dengan id label nama.
Menunggu: Anda harus memiliki elemen label dengan id label email.
Menunggu: Anda harus memiliki elemen label dengan id label nomor.
Menunggu: #label nama Anda harus berisi teks yang menjelaskan masukan.
Menunggu: #label-email Anda harus berisi teks yang menjelaskan masukan.
Menunggu: #nomor-label Anda harus berisi teks yang menjelaskan masukan.
Menunggu: #label-nama Anda harus turunan dari #form-survey.
Menunggu: #label-email Anda harus turunan dari #formulir-survei.
Menunggu: #nomor-label Anda harus turunan dari #survey-form.
Menunggu: #nama Anda harus memiliki atribut dan nilai placeholder.
Menunggu: #email Anda harus memiliki atribut dan nilai placeholder.
Menunggu: #nomor Anda harus memiliki atribut dan nilai placeholder.
Menunggu: Anda harus memiliki bidang pilih dengan id dropdown.
Menunggu: #dropdown Anda harus memiliki setidaknya dua elemen opsi yang dapat dipilih (bukan dinonaktifkan).
Menunggu: #dropdown Anda harus turunan dari #survey-form.
Menunggu: Anda harus memiliki setidaknya dua elemen masukan dengan jenis radio (tombol radio).
Menunggu: Anda harus memiliki setidaknya dua tombol radio yang merupakan turunan dari #survey-form.
Menunggu: Semua tombol radio Anda harus memiliki atribut nilai dan nilai.
Menunggu: Semua tombol radio Anda harus memiliki atribut nama dan nilai.
Menunggu: Setiap grup tombol radio harus memiliki setidaknya 2 tombol radio.
Menunggu: Anda harus memiliki setidaknya dua elemen masukan dengan jenis kotak centang (kotak centang) yang merupakan turunan dari #survey-form.
Menunggu: Semua kotak centang Anda di dalam #survey-form harus memiliki atribut nilai dan nilai.
Menunggu: Anda harus memiliki setidaknya satu elemen textarea yang merupakan turunan dari #survey-form.
Menunggu: Anda harus memiliki input atau elemen tombol dengan id kirim.
Menunggu: #kirim Anda harus memiliki jenis kiriman.
Menunggu: #submit Anda harus turunan dari #survey-form.
0 comments:
Posting Komentar